Favorite Sports Memory:
- Favorite memory is going to St. Louis for the NCAA Championship tournament! Super cool to experience as a freshman and it was a really fun trip.


Favorite Moment as an MIT Student-Athlete:
- Regional championships, when a huge crowd came for the game, including the women's soccer team and a lot of other student-athlete friends. Felt like being a part of a really big family to see their support!


Off the Court at MIT:
- Majoring in artificial intelligence and decision making with a concentration in creative writing
- Internship: Built a model for detecting wash trading and improving security with NFT trading at a start up.
- Research: Worked with the MTL Lab on a project to build a model for using ultrasound measurements to predict the blood pressure waveform.


Why I Chose MIT:
- I wanted to be in an environment where I was encouraged to pursue my goals both athletically and academically. I felt that MIT is the right place for me because it emphasized a balance between the two, and gave me the opportunities of a world class education while playing the sport I love. After getting to know the players, I knew that I would love spending the next four years here with such a welcoming and inspirational cast of people around me. Their infectious passion and the diversity that Boston has to offer made me confident that I would have an amazing time at MIT.
